Rotary Kiln Pyrolysis Design Calculations Rotary Kiln

Rotary kilns carry out pyrolysis at temperatures ranging from 800°F to 1400°F. Because pyrolysis is a "starved-air" process, meaning it occurs in the absence of oxygen, the rotary kiln must be carefully sealed to create the necessary inert processing environment. Read More.

Pyrolysis Rotary Kiln Heat Transfer Calculations

Pyrolysis Rotary Kiln Heat Transfer Calculations. In this work a numerical model for pyrolysis of lignocellulosic biomass in a rotary kiln is developed The model is based on a set of conservation equations for mass and energy combined with independent submodels for the pyrolysis reaction heat transfer and granular flow inside the kiln.

Mathematical Modeling and Experimental Investigation of ...

total residence time distribution in the rotary kiln can then be calculated with the help of Laplace transformation. 4 Basic Models . In rotary kiln reactors the heat transfer to the bed takes place either • directly through a combustion gas or • indirectly through an external heater.

Principles of Heat Transfer as Applied to Rotary Dryers ...

Whether you are using a rotary dryer, rotary kiln, or rotary cooler, there is one thing that all these instruments have in common: they all use methods of heat transfer to carry out their jobs.Heat transfer is how heat moves from one source to another. Understanding the types of heat transfer, and how they differ, is an important part in understanding how a rotary dryer, cooler, or kiln works.
